State Institution of Higher Professional Education
"Belarusian-Russian University"

Mogilev Mechanical Engineering Institute was founded on September 1, 1961 by № 714 resolution of the USSR Council of Ministers of August 10, 1961 and by № 504 resolution of the BSSR Council of Ministers of August 22, 1961. The Institute became a unique Institution of Education of such kind in Belarus.
By №198 order of the Minister of Education of the Republic of Belarus of May 17, 2000 Mogilev Mechanical Engineering Institute was transformed into Mogilev State Technical University (MSTU).
According to the agreement between the government of the Republic of Belarus and the government of the Russian Federation signed on January 19, 2001 in Mogilev by orders of the Ministry of Education of the Russian Federation and the Ministry of Education of the Republic of Belarus № 3862/518 of November 28, 2001 and №2102/206 of May 15, 2003 and by order of the Ministry of Education of the Republic of Belarus №371 of September 23, 2003 the University was transformed into the State Institution of Higher Professional Education "Belarusian-Russian University"(Belarusian-Russian University).
The Rector of the University is Igor Sergeevich Sazonov, Doctor of Engineering Sciences, Professor.
Belarusian - Russian University is the largest regional scientific and technical center, comprising Professional Development and Retraining Institute, the college of architecture and construction and lyceum.
Belarusian - Russian University has 5 faculties for full-time tuition: automechanical, mechanical engineering, construction, electrical engineering and economics. There is a correspondence faculty and a faculty of pre-university preparation.
Specialists of 16 specialities and of 31 specialization fields in compliance with Belarusian Educational Standarts of 5 specialities with Russian Educational Standarts are trained at the University. The college of architecture and construction trains students in 4 fields. The Professional Development and Retraining Institute allows people with higher education to be retrained and get another higher education in one of the 9 specialities. The student body of the University is more than 7500, the total number of students in all structural subdivisions is over 12000 people.
Studies are held in 7 buildings equipped with modern teaching aids. The library resource accounts for over 1,5 mln copies of textbooks and teaching manuals. The University has a publishing center with a good stock of modern copiers.
Specialists of the highest qualification are trained through magistracy, post-graduate studies and as external post-graduates in 15 scientific fields. There is a specialized Board for the defending dissertations and awarding the Candidate's of Science degree. The University publishes periodically a scientific journal "Vestnik of Belarusian-Russian University" and a collection of scientific works. International scientific and technical conferences are held at the University annually.
The University maintains links with educational institutions, organizations and scientists of CIS countries and of Australia, Bulgaria, Germany, Egypt, Nepal, Poland, Russia, Syria, Slovakia, the USA, the Ukraine, Sweden, Yugoslavia.
There is a department on work with foreign students at the University. Citizens of foreign countries enter Belarusian-Russian University on the basis of contract providing for tuition fee by physical and juridical persons.
Tuition fee is $1800 per year. Education of foreign citizens is available on all faculties in Russian. The University puts a hostel at students' disposal.
Foreign citizens who don't know Russian study on the pre-university preparatory department of the university for a year to learn the Russian language. The tuition fee on the pre-university preparatory faculty is $1100 per year.
Upon graduation a student is given a diploma of the international standart.
Foreign citizens have studied at the University since 1985. Since then students from 36 countries have got education here. Students from China, Syria, Iran, Jordan, Lebanon, Yemen, Morocco, Tunisia and Palestine are studying at the Belarusian-Russian University nowadays.
